OCTOBER'S AIR FIGHTING.
LONDON, November 3. (Received November 4. at 10.55 a.m.) According to the communiques, 171 aeroplanes were lost on the west front in October. The British downed 39, the French 65, and the Germans 77. The September total was over 300. [Ambiguity in the cabling of the above message leaves an alternative reading—i.e., that the number of British machines brought down was 39, French 65, and German, 77.]
